Why Secure API Integration of Real-Time Equipment Data Is Critical for Construction Site Efficiency
In today’s fast-paced construction environment, securely integrating real-time equipment monitoring data from multiple vendors through APIs is no longer optional—it’s essential. Construction sites generate vast streams of data from heavy machinery sensors, safety systems, and operational tools, often managed by disparate vendors with incompatible platforms. Without a unified, secure integration approach, this data remains siloed, causing delays, miscommunication, suboptimal asset utilization, and increased safety risks.
A strategic, secure API integration framework transforms fragmented information into a cohesive, actionable view that construction teams can trust. Key benefits include:
- Real-time operational visibility: Aggregates equipment status and alerts across all vendors instantly, enabling proactive management.
- Predictive maintenance: Leverages sensor data to forecast equipment failures and schedule repairs before costly breakdowns occur.
- Workflow automation: Dynamically assigns tasks based on real-time machine availability and condition, optimizing resource allocation.
- Enhanced safety compliance: Provides continuous monitoring and immediate hazard detection to protect workers and assets.
- Vendor-neutral interoperability: Seamlessly integrates best-in-class equipment regardless of manufacturer, future-proofing operations.
By prioritizing both security and interoperability, construction teams unlock the full potential of multi-vendor equipment data, driving efficiency, safety, and significant cost savings on-site.
Understanding API Integration Strategies and Their Importance in Construction
What Is an API Integration Strategy?
For software engineers in construction labor, an API integration strategy is a planned, systematic approach to securely connect diverse software systems, devices, and platforms through Application Programming Interfaces (APIs). This enables seamless, real-time data exchange between equipment telemetry, vendor platforms, and construction management tools.
In brief:
A set of best practices and technical methods for linking disparate systems via APIs to enable smooth data flow, process automation, and secure communication.
Why Are API Integration Strategies Vital for Construction?
Construction sites rely on equipment from multiple vendors, each with unique data formats, security protocols, and update frequencies. Without a cohesive strategy, integrating these data streams leads to inefficiencies and risks. A robust API integration strategy ensures:
- Data security: Protects sensitive telemetry and operational data from unauthorized access.
- Data consistency: Normalizes diverse vendor data into a standardized format for reliable analysis.
- Real-time responsiveness: Manages latency to support immediate decision-making.
- Reliability: Implements error handling and monitoring to maintain uptime and data integrity.
- Vendor compatibility: Adapts to different API capabilities without vendor lock-in.
This balanced approach aligns technical infrastructure with business goals, enabling construction teams to harness multi-vendor data securely and efficiently.
Proven Strategies to Securely Integrate Multi-Vendor Equipment Data
To build a resilient and scalable integration ecosystem, implement these core strategies:
| Strategy | Purpose | Implementation Tips |
|---|---|---|
| 1. Standardize Data Formats | Harmonize diverse vendor data for unified analysis | Use JSON Schema; build transformation layers |
| 2. Enforce Robust Authentication | Protect telemetry from unauthorized access | Adopt OAuth 2.0, API keys, IP whitelisting |
| 3. Use Event-Driven Architecture | Minimize latency with instant updates | Implement webhooks and streaming APIs |
| 4. Deploy Middleware/API Gateways | Abstract vendor API differences; centralize control | Use Kong or Apigee for routing and normalization |
| 5. Validate and Cleanse Data | Ensure data integrity before analysis | Build validation rules; log anomalies |
| 6. Design for Scalability & Fault Tolerance | Maintain uptime and handle network issues | Use Kafka queues; implement retry mechanisms |
| 7. Automate Workflow Triggers | Link equipment status to project management actions | Set up API-driven task assignment and alerts |
| 8. Implement Comprehensive Monitoring | Detect and resolve integration issues proactively | Use ELK stack or monitoring dashboards |
Each strategy addresses specific challenges in multi-vendor integration, collectively ensuring a secure, efficient, and scalable system.
Step-by-Step Guide: Implementing Secure API Integration Strategies
1. Standardize Data Formats Across Vendor APIs
- Catalog vendor data schemas: Collect and analyze all vendor API documentation to identify common fields such as equipment ID, status, and sensor readings.
- Define a unified JSON schema: Establish a comprehensive data model accommodating essential data points across all equipment types.
- Develop transformation pipelines: Build middleware services that convert vendor-specific formats into the unified schema during data ingestion.
- Conduct rigorous testing: Validate transformations using sample data sets from all vendors to ensure accuracy and completeness.
Example: Use a JSON Schema validator to enforce consistent data structures before feeding data into analytics platforms.
2. Enforce Robust Authentication and Authorization
- Assess vendor authentication methods: Identify whether OAuth 2.0, API keys, or other protocols are required.
- Secure credential storage: Utilize secure vaults like AWS Secrets Manager or HashiCorp Vault to manage API keys and tokens safely.
- Implement token refresh and rate limiting: Automate token lifecycle management and prevent abuse or outages by enforcing API usage limits.
- Enforce encrypted connections: Require HTTPS/TLS for all API calls and implement IP whitelisting to restrict access.
Example: Configure OAuth 2.0 flows with token refresh for long-running integrations to avoid downtime.
3. Use Event-Driven Architecture for Real-Time Updates
- Prioritize vendors supporting webhooks or streaming APIs: Push-based data delivery reduces latency compared to polling.
- Build webhook receivers or Kafka consumers: Capture events such as equipment status changes immediately as they occur.
- Implement retry logic and dead-letter queues: Ensure failed events are retried or logged for manual intervention without data loss.
- Integrate with workflow automation: Trigger task assignments or alerts in project management tools based on real-time data.
Example: Connect forklift status updates via webhooks to automatically dispatch operators through your workflow system.
4. Deploy Middleware or API Gateways for Abstraction and Control
- Select an appropriate platform: Use open-source Kong for flexibility or cloud-based Apigee for enterprise-grade features, depending on your team’s expertise.
- Configure unified API endpoints: Route all vendor APIs through the gateway, enforcing consistent authentication and throttling policies.
- Normalize API responses: Translate vendor-specific data into standardized formats to simplify downstream processing.
- Monitor gateway health: Use built-in dashboards to detect bottlenecks and optimize performance.
Example: Use Kong plugins to transform vendor-specific JSON responses into your unified schema in real time.
5. Validate and Cleanse Incoming Data
- Define validation rules: Check timestamp formats, sensor value ranges, mandatory fields, and data types.
- Implement validation modules: Reject or flag invalid data early in the ingestion pipeline to prevent corrupted analytics.
- Create cleansing scripts: Automatically correct minor errors, fill missing values where possible, and log anomalies for review.
- Maintain audit trails: Track validation outcomes to support compliance and continuous improvement.
Example: Use Great Expectations framework to automate data quality checks before storing telemetry data.
6. Design for Scalability and Fault Tolerance
- Adopt asynchronous messaging platforms: Use Apache Kafka or RabbitMQ to buffer and distribute data streams reliably.
- Implement retry and backoff policies: Handle transient failures gracefully without data loss.
- Deploy redundant services: Ensure failover mechanisms are in place to maintain uptime during outages.
- Regularly test failover scenarios: Simulate outages during maintenance windows to validate system resilience.
Example: Configure Kafka topics with replication and partitioning to handle increasing data volumes without downtime.
7. Automate Workflow Triggers Based on Equipment Status
- Map equipment states to project actions: Define how states like idle, active, or maintenance-needed trigger specific workflows.
- Integrate with project management APIs: Automatically create tasks, update schedules, or send alerts when equipment status changes.
- Set up notification rules: Notify operators, supervisors, and maintenance teams instantly via email, SMS, or dashboards.
- Monitor and optimize: Track task completion rates and adjust triggers to improve efficiency.
Example: When a crane enters maintenance mode, automatically assign a repair task in your construction management system.
8. Implement Comprehensive Monitoring and Logging
- Instrument all API clients and servers: Use centralized logging frameworks such as the ELK stack (Elasticsearch, Logstash, Kibana).
- Collect key performance metrics: Monitor response times, error rates, throughput, and security events.
- Create dashboards and alerts: Set thresholds to detect anomalies and SLA breaches proactively.
- Review logs regularly: Use insights to identify bottlenecks and improve system reliability.
Example: Set up Kibana dashboards to visualize API latency spikes and receive Slack alerts for critical failures.
Real-World Use Cases: How API Integration Strategies Drive Construction Efficiency
| Use Case | Challenge | Solution | Outcome |
|---|---|---|---|
| Real-Time Crane Monitoring | Multiple vendor APIs with inconsistent data | Standardized schema + event-driven webhooks | Reduced crane idle time by 15% |
| Predictive Maintenance on Earth Movers | Sensor noise and data inconsistency | Middleware + data validation + ML integration | 30% fewer unexpected breakdowns |
| Automated Forklift Dispatch | Vendor API discrepancies and latency | API gateway + event-driven triggers | 25% boost in material handling efficiency |
These examples illustrate how combining standardized data, event-driven architectures, and middleware abstraction leads to measurable operational improvements.
How to Measure the Success of Your API Integration Efforts
| Strategy | Key Performance Indicator (KPI) | Measurement Approach |
|---|---|---|
| Data Format Standardization | Reduction in data ingestion errors | Compare error rates before and after deployment |
| Authentication & Authorization | Number of security incidents or unauthorized access | Monitor security logs and audit trails |
| Event-Driven Architecture | Event-to-action latency | Timestamp events and measure processing delays |
| Middleware/API Gateway Usage | Average API response time and error rates | Use API gateway monitoring dashboards |
| Data Validation and Cleansing | Percentage of invalid data flagged or corrected | Analyze validation logs |
| Scalability and Fault Tolerance | System uptime and mean time to recovery (MTTR) | Use infrastructure monitoring tools |
| Workflow Automation Triggers | Task assignment latency and completion rate | Analyze workflow system logs |
| Monitoring and Logging | Number of detected issues and resolution time | Track incidents via monitoring dashboards |
Tracking these KPIs ensures your integration delivers tangible benefits and maintains high reliability.
Essential Tools for Secure API Integration in Construction
| Tool Category | Tool Name | Description | Business Outcome | Link |
|---|---|---|---|---|
| API Gateway | Kong | Open-source API gateway with routing and management | Simplifies multi-vendor API management, improves security | konghq.com |
| Apigee | Cloud-based API management platform | Enterprise-grade security and analytics | cloud.google.com/apigee | |
| Middleware Platforms | MuleSoft | Integration platform with extensive connectors | Handles complex workflows and data transformations | mulesoft.com |
| Node.js Middleware | Custom lightweight API abstraction | High customization for unique vendor APIs | N/A | |
| Event Streaming | Apache Kafka | Distributed streaming platform for real-time data | Enables scalable, fault-tolerant data ingestion | kafka.apache.org |
| AWS Kinesis | Managed streaming data service | Fully managed; integrates with AWS ecosystem | aws.amazon.com/kinesis | |
| Data Validation | JSON Schema Validator | Libraries to validate JSON data | Ensures data consistency at ingestion | Varies by language |
| Great Expectations | Data quality testing and validation framework | Supports complex data validation scenarios | greatexpectations.io | |
| Customer Feedback | Zigpoll | Real-time survey and feedback platform | Captures operator insights to optimize workflows | zigpoll.com |
How Zigpoll Enhances Construction API Integrations
Zigpoll integrates naturally with construction management platforms to capture real-time feedback from operators and site managers. This qualitative data complements equipment telemetry, providing a fuller picture of workflow efficiency and identifying bottlenecks that sensors alone might miss.
Concrete Example: After automating forklift dispatch using event-driven triggers and API gateways, Zigpoll surveys can gauge operator satisfaction and highlight training needs. This continuous feedback loop enables iterative improvements in both technology and human workflows, driving sustained productivity gains.
Prioritizing API Integration Efforts for Maximum Construction Impact
To maximize ROI and minimize risk, follow this prioritized approach:
- Start with critical, high-volume vendor APIs: Focus on equipment generating the most valuable data streams first.
- Secure all data flows: Implement strong authentication and encryption from day one to protect sensitive telemetry.
- Implement event-driven updates: Enable real-time workflows that accelerate decision-making and responsiveness.
- Address data quality upfront: Clean, validated data forms the foundation for reliable analytics and automation.
- Build scalable infrastructure incrementally: Align capacity with current needs but design for future growth.
- Set up comprehensive monitoring early: Detect and resolve issues before they impact operations.
Implementation Checklist for Secure API Integration on Construction Sites
- Inventory all vendor APIs and document authentication methods
- Define a unified data model and build transformation pipelines
- Establish secure credential storage and access policies
- Develop webhook listeners or streaming consumers for real-time data
- Deploy an API gateway or middleware to unify endpoints
- Implement data validation and cleansing processes
- Configure message queues for fault-tolerant ingestion
- Automate workflow triggers based on equipment telemetry
- Set up monitoring dashboards and alerting systems
- Schedule regular reviews and updates of integration components
Getting Started: Securely Integrating Real-Time Equipment Data
- Conduct a comprehensive vendor API audit: Gather documentation, test endpoints, and assess data formats and security protocols.
- Design your integration architecture: Choose middleware, event streaming platforms, and validation layers aligned with your site’s complexity and vendor ecosystem.
- Develop and test data transformation modules: Use sandbox environments to ensure data accuracy and integration reliability.
- Implement security best practices: Enforce TLS encryption, credential rotation, and strict access controls.
- Build real-time event handlers: Develop webhook receivers and integrate with project management and workflow tools.
- Set up monitoring and alerts: Track integration health with dashboards and automated notifications.
- Iterate based on feedback: Use operator input via tools like Zigpoll and data quality metrics to refine and optimize your system continuously.
FAQ: Common Questions About Secure API Integration for Construction Equipment
How can I securely integrate real-time equipment monitoring data from multiple vendors?
Implement strong authentication protocols such as OAuth 2.0, enforce encrypted communication with TLS, centralize security management using API gateways, and rigorously validate incoming data to prevent malicious inputs.
What are best practices for handling different data formats from multiple equipment vendors?
Standardize all incoming data into a unified schema using middleware transformation layers. Apply validation and cleansing processes to ensure consistency and reliability before analysis.
How do I reduce latency in real-time API integrations on construction sites?
Adopt event-driven architectures using webhooks or streaming APIs instead of polling. Employ asynchronous message queues like Apache Kafka to handle data surges efficiently.
Which tools help efficiently integrate multiple vendor APIs?
API gateways such as Kong and Apigee manage routing, security, and normalization. Event streaming platforms like Apache Kafka facilitate high-throughput data ingestion. Middleware like MuleSoft simplifies complex workflows. For capturing operator insights, platforms such as Zigpoll offer seamless real-time feedback integration.
How do I automate workflows based on real-time equipment data?
Map equipment statuses to specific workflow triggers within project management tools. Use event-driven API calls to auto-create tasks, send alerts, and optimize resource allocation dynamically.
Expected Outcomes from Implementing Robust API Integration Strategies
| Outcome | Impact on Construction Site Operations |
|---|---|
| Reduced Equipment Downtime | Faster detection and resolution of machinery issues |
| Improved Resource Utilization | Dynamic task assignments based on real-time equipment status |
| Enhanced Safety Monitoring | Immediate alerts for hazardous or abnormal conditions |
| Increased Data Accuracy | Reliable analytics enabling informed decision-making |
| Vendor Interoperability | Flexibility to integrate best equipment regardless of vendor |
| Scalable Infrastructure | Supports growth and increasing data volumes seamlessly |
Securely integrating real-time equipment monitoring data across multiple vendors with a well-planned API strategy empowers construction teams to optimize workflows, enhance safety, and boost productivity. Leveraging tools like Kong for API management, Apache Kafka for event streaming, and platforms such as Zigpoll for actionable operator feedback creates a comprehensive ecosystem that drives smarter, faster construction site operations.